Opinion of the Court
Appellant sued appellee for a broker’s commission, alleged to have accrued by reason of appellant finding a purchaser for a certain lot in Dallas listed with him, as agent, for sale, and" which, it was alleged, appellee sold to the purchaser discovered by appellant, who was the procuring cause of the sale made.
The judgment upon the facts is conclusive of the issue, and we are not authorized to disturb it in the absence of some harmful error of procedure. No such error is disclosed by the record or pointed out in appellant’s brief.
Accordingly, the judgment of the court below is affirmed.
